#-*- coding: utf-8 -*-
__author__ = "James P Burke"
__version__ = '0.2.4'
__license__ = 'LGPL v3.0'
### CUT HERE (see setup.py)
import inspect
import logging
from pydal import DAL, Field
from bottle import HTTPError
logger = logging.getLogger(__name__)
class DALPlugin(object):
''' This plugin passes an DAL database handle to route callbacks
that accept a `db` keyword argument. If a callback does not expect
such a parameter, no connection is made.'''
name = 'pydal'
api = 2
def __init__(self,
uri='sqlite://storage.sqlite',
autocommit=False,
pool_size=0, folder=None,
db_codec='UTF-8', check_reserved=None,
migrate=False, fake_migrate=False,
migrate_enabled=False, fake_migrate_all=False,
decode_credentials=False, driver_args=None,
adapter_args=None, attempts=5, auto_import=False,
define_tables=None, bigint_id=False, debug=False,
lazy_tables=False, db_uid=None, do_connect=True,
after_connection=None, tables=None,
ignore_field_case=True, entity_quoting=False,
table_hash=None,
keyword='db'):
self.uri = uri
self.autocommit = autocommit
self.pool_size = pool_size
self.folder = folder
self.db_codec = db_codec
self.check_reserved = check_reserved
self.migrate = migrate
self.fake_migrate = fake_migrate
self.migrate_enabled = migrate_enabled
self.fake_migrate_all = fake_migrate_all
self.decode_credentials = decode_credentials
self.driver_args = driver_args
self.adapter_args = adapter_args
self.attempts = attempts
self.auto_import = auto_import
self.bigint_id = bigint_id
self.debug = debug
self.lazy_tables = lazy_tables
self.db_uid = db_uid
self.do_connect = do_connect
self.after_connection = after_connection
self.tables = tables
self.ignore_field_case = ignore_field_case
self.entity_quoting = entity_quoting
self.table_hash = table_hash
self.define_tables = define_tables
self.keyword = keyword
self.db = None
def setup(self, app):
''' Make sure that other installed plugins don't affect the same
keyword argument.'''
for other in app.plugins:
if not isinstance(other, DALPlugin): continue
if other.keyword == self.keyword:
raise PluginError("Found another DAL plugin with "\
"conflicting settings (non-unique keyword).")
# Connect to the database
if self.pool_size:
self._connect()
def apply(self, callback, context):
# Test if the original callback accepts a 'db' keyword.
# Ignore it if it does not need a database handle.
conf = context.config.get('db') or {}
args = context.get_callback_args()
if self.keyword not in args:
return callback
def wrapper(*args, **kwargs):
# Connect to the database
if not self.pool_size:
self._connect()
# Add the connection handle as a keyword argument.
kwargs[self.keyword] = self.db
try:
rv = callback(*args, **kwargs)
if self.autocommit: self.db.commit()
except Exception as e:
logger.error(e, exc_info=True)
self.db.rollback()
raise HTTPError(500, "Database Error", e)
return rv
# Replace the route callback with the wrapped one.
return wrapper
def _connect(self):
self.db = DAL(self.uri,
pool_size=self.pool_size,
folder=self.folder,
db_codec=self.db_codec,
check_reserved=self.check_reserved,
migrate=self.migrate,
fake_migrate=self.fake_migrate,
migrate_enabled=self.migrate_enabled,
fake_migrate_all=self.fake_migrate_all,
decode_credentials=self.decode_credentials,
driver_args=self.driver_args,
adapter_args=self.adapter_args,
attempts=self.attempts,
auto_import=self.auto_import,
bigint_id=self.bigint_id,
debug=self.debug,
lazy_tables=self.lazy_tables,
db_uid=self.db_uid,
do_connect=self.do_connect,
after_connection=self.after_connection,
tables=self.tables,
ignore_field_case=self.ignore_field_case,
entity_quoting=self.entity_quoting,
table_hash=self.table_hash
)
if self.define_tables: # tables definitions
self.define_tables(self.db)
Plugin = DALPlugin
